A randomised controlled trial testing the efficacy and cost benefit of cognitivebehavioural therapy and/or simulation-based learning resources on the mental healthoutcomes of chronic obstructive pulmonary disease patients

入选标准
- •1) A confirmed diagnosis of COPD by respiratory physicians
- •2) A positive screen for anxiety and/or depression on the BAI and BDI-II, respectively.
排除标准
- •1) Life expectancy of less than six months
- •2) Currently involved in another research study
- •3) An illness exacerbation resulting in hospitalisation within the previous month
- •4) Diagnosis of dementia
- •5) Known difficulty with either their eye-sight, fluency in English or filling out self-report measures.
